Downspout Cleaning in Morris County, NJ
Downspout cleaning services involve removing debris, leaves, and obstructions from the downspouts and attached drainage systems to ensure proper water flow away from the property. This service typically covers residential projects such as clearing clogged or overflowing downspouts, inspecting for damage or leaks, and ensuring the entire gutter system functions effectively during heavy rainfall or storm events. Property owners often want to understand the importance of regular maintenance to prevent water damage, foundation issues, and basement flooding, especially in areas prone to seasonal storms.
Before requesting downspout cleaning, homeowners should consider the current condition of their gutter system and whether there are signs of clogs, leaks, or sagging sections. It’s helpful to know if the downspouts are directing water at appropriate distances from the foundation and whether any repairs are needed in addition to cleaning. Proper assessment can help determine if additional services, such as gutter repairs or installation of screens, are necessary to maintain an effective drainage system around the property.

Downspout Cleaning Questions
Why is downspout cleaning important? Regular cleaning prevents clogs that can cause water damage and foundation issues around Morris County homes.
How often should downspouts be cleaned? It is recommended to clean downspouts at least twice a year, especially after fall and winter seasons.
What signs indicate downspouts need cleaning? Overflowing water, visible debris, or pooling around the foundation are common signs that cleaning is needed.
What types of debris are typically removed during cleaning? Leaves, twigs, dirt, and any other blockages that can impede water flow are removed during the service.
